A bstract

C onvective heat and mass transfer through large openings play an important role in the thermal behaviour of buildings.
T hese phenomena becomeeven more determinant in the case of naturally ventilated buildings. This paper reviews the models
d escribing the involved phenomena due to gravitational and boundary layer pumping flows proposed up to 1992. A sensitivity
a nalysis is also presented, aimed at a comparison of these models and a determination of the points requiring further research.

1. Introduction

N atural convection i's the main heat transfer mecha nism in many solar energy applications. Operation of
t hermosyphonic solar collectors is based on natural
c onvection; this is the cetse also in conventional buildings
a nd mainly in passive solar ones. Natural convection,
i f intelligently applied, can also significantly contribute
t o the natural coolingof buildings.
H eat flows convectively through the different zones
o f buildings since there are zones where heat is absorbed,
s uch as south rooms or sunspaces, and others that are
c ooler. Natural convection is also the main heat exchange
m echanism between a building and the environment.
W hen for instance during summer the windows of a
b uilding zone are opened, there is heat exchangewith
t he ambience, due to the temperature difference bet ween the inside and outside air, even if the wind
velocity outside is practically zero.
N atural convection between different building zones
is due to the air temperature difference between these
z ones. These differences in the air temperature are
d ue to the temperature differences between the various
s urfaces of the zonesinvolved or to the presence of
i nternal heating or cooling sources. Surfaces located
in south oriented zones are wanner during the day,
since they absorb solar radiation that enters the space.
A lso other surfaces can be heated up due to the contact

w ith auxiliary heating equipment, or because theyare
p art of a heat storage medium. Cold surfaces are
windows (mainly during winter) and the surfaces of
d ischarged thermal storage media. This situation can
b e reversed during the night; south glazing can be the
c old surfaces and the thermal storage media the hot
o nes.
K nowledge of the physical laws describing natural
c onvection through the zones of a multi-zone building
isnecessary to accurately predict the temperature dist ribution inside the various zones. The contribution of
t hese considerations to the design of a building is that
k nowing these mechanisms, the dimensions and locat ions of the openings between the various zones can
b e designed in such a way to give a more homogeneous
t emperature distribution inside the building and theref ore avoid overheating.Also, in the case of passive
c ooling design, natural heat extraction mechanisms can
b e maximised by optimising the characteristics of these
o penings.
T his paper focuses on heat and mass transfer by
n atural convection through large openings between
a djacent zones in buildings. This is due to the following
t wo mechanisms:
